Package com.pulumi.gcp.compute.inputs
Class FirewallDenyArgs
- java.lang.Object
-
- com.pulumi.resources.InputArgs
-
- com.pulumi.resources.ResourceArgs
-
- com.pulumi.gcp.compute.inputs.FirewallDenyArgs
-
public final class FirewallDenyArgs extends com.pulumi.resources.ResourceArgs
-
-
Nested Class Summary
Nested Classes Modifier and Type Class Description static class
FirewallDenyArgs.Builder
-
Field Summary
Fields Modifier and Type Field Description static FirewallDenyArgs
Empty
-
Method Summary
All Methods Static Methods Instance Methods Concrete Methods Modifier and Type Method Description static FirewallDenyArgs.Builder
builder()
static FirewallDenyArgs.Builder
builder(FirewallDenyArgs defaults)
java.util.Optional<com.pulumi.core.Output<java.util.List<java.lang.String>>>
ports()
com.pulumi.core.Output<java.lang.String>
protocol()
-
-
-
Field Detail
-
Empty
public static final FirewallDenyArgs Empty
-
-
Method Detail
-
ports
public java.util.Optional<com.pulumi.core.Output<java.util.List<java.lang.String>>> ports()
- Returns:
- An optional list of ports to which this rule applies. This field is only applicable for UDP or TCP protocol. Each entry must be either an integer or a range. If not specified, this rule applies to connections through any port. Example inputs include: ["22"], ["80","443"], and ["12345-12349"].
-
protocol
public com.pulumi.core.Output<java.lang.String> protocol()
- Returns:
- The IP protocol to which this rule applies. The protocol type is required when creating a firewall rule. This value can either be one of the following well known protocol strings (tcp, udp, icmp, esp, ah, sctp, ipip, all), or the IP protocol number.
-
builder
public static FirewallDenyArgs.Builder builder()
-
builder
public static FirewallDenyArgs.Builder builder(FirewallDenyArgs defaults)
-
-